我正在做我自己的ajax东西下拉。我定位了一个选择标签的输入。当东西输入到输入时,它从数据库收集并填充选择菜单。问题是它不明显。有没有办法让选择菜单打开,就好像用户点击了它?触发器选择标签显示选项
1
A
回答
3
不,你将不得不使用类似于DIV
和overflow: auto
的东西来模拟打开的选择行为。
0
HTML5 <datalist>
元素在这里会有帮助,但由于目前只有少数浏览器支持它,所以您将不得不依赖JS实现。
以下是我能从简单的Google搜索中找到的最少的错误实现
http://dhtmlx.com/docs/products/dhtmlxCombo/index.shtml。它支持Ajax以及上/下箭头键。
当你开始输入标签时,StackOverflow也使用自己的自动完成实现,也许你可以从源代码中获得一些想法?
相关问题
- 1. 选择标签显示小写选项
- 2. 选择选择显示组标签和选项选择
- 3. 在外部触发器上显示选择框选项
- 4. 在选择标签下的选择下拉选项中显示商标(TM)
- 5. 选择标签/选项标签麻烦
- 6. 突出显示从键盘输入选择标签选项
- 7. XAML触发器WPF选项卡选项变化超过标签标题
- 8. 在选择标签中显示选项或选项内容的一部分
- 9. 如何在标签上显示日期选择器选定值
- 10. React选择标签不显示
- 11. 获取显示选择标签
- 12. jQuery的选择2显示OPTGROUP标签
- 13. 显示空格选项标签
- 14. 标签中显示的选定项目
- 15. 触摸屏选择选项(html选择标签)的解决方案
- 16. 显示不同选择选项上的选择选项
- 17. 显示一个选择选项基于其他选择选项
- 18. 显示从选择到另一个选择标题的选择选项
- 19. NSTimer未触发选择器
- 20. 选择标签的选项右对齐
- 21. 在ror中选择选项标签?
- 22. 单击标签,选择一个选项
- 23. 所有未选择的选项标签
- 24. ng选项不更新选择标签
- 25. 选择框和获取选项标签
- 26. 带触发器的选择复选框?
- 27. vue.js:选择不触发事件@change选择/选项
- 28. jQuery标签选择器
- 29. Mvc Dropdownlist选择选择器不显示
- 30. c选择具有显示标签表的标签